Crisp Peanut Butter Cookies

  • Total Time: 33 minutes
  • Yield: Approximately 24 cookies 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 3/4 cup packed light brown s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ract
  • 1 cup creamy peanut butter
  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(177°C) and line two ba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. In a bowl, cream together softened butter and both sugars until smooth. Add eggs one at a time along with vanilla extract and peanut butter; mix well.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t. Gradually add dry mixture to wet ingredients until just combined.
  4. Chill the dough for at least 3 hours before shaping it into balls about 1.5 tablespoons each.
  5. Roll each ball in granulated sugar if desired and place on prepared baking sheets. Press down with a fork to create criss-cross patterns.
  6. Bake for 12–13 minutes until edges are lightly browned but centers remain soft. Cool on the baking sheet for about 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ack.
